Frequency Bands Frequency Band NameFrequency RangeWavelength (Meters)High Frequency (HF)3-30 MHz10-100 mVery High Frequency (VHF)30-300 MHz1-10 mUltra High Frequency (UHF)300-3000 MHz10-100 cmSuper High Frequency (SHF)3-30 GHz1-10 cmFrequency Bands – Antenna Theory www.antenna-theory.com › basics › freqBands

Read moreWhat is the frequency band for RF?
Radio frequency (RF) is the oscillation rate of an alternating electric current or voltage or of a magnetic, electric or electromagnetic field or mechanical system in the frequency range from around 20 kHz to around 300 GHz .

Read moreWhat is 700mhz?
The 700 MHz band is actually the set of frequencies between 698 and 806 MHz , which puts them in the Ultra High Frequency, or UHF, range of radio frequencies. In the United States, these were and are still used as television channels 52 through 69.
Read moreWhat two frequency bands do wireless LANS use?
WLAN technology transmits information in space by using radio waves on the 2.4GHz and 5GHz frequency bands.
